went to the track tonight for test n tune. ran a bet of 9.53. The slip read



r/t .045
60 ft 1.476
330 4.017
1/8 6.142
mph 114.50
1000 7.996
1/4 9.573
mph 142.55



took out a zx14 which put the topping on my cake tonight

gen 1. 16/42 gears. muzzy full. power cmd. 6 in stretch

Care to share your launch technique? What rpm do you stage at? That is a pretty good 60ft. What tire are you using? Air pressure? Shift points? Sorry if that is too many questions. I am always looking to learn.
 
I'm launching at about 5000rpms sliding the clutch, running a shinko 190 ultra soft at 15lbs. shifting about 10,800. I'm always looking to improve myself.
